LC 3372 Legislature · 2025 Regular Session

Generally revise laws related to tourism lodging on ranches

This bill (LC 3372) proposed revisions to laws governing tourism lodging on ranches but did not become law. It was assigned to a drafter in December 2024 but died in committee on May 27, 2025, meaning no changes to these regulations were enacted. The bill's title indicates it aimed to update legal frameworks for ranch-based tourism accommodations, but no specific provisions or affected parties are documented in its status. As a draft that failed to advance, it had no effect on current law or stakeholders.
